Today, the landscape of romantic drama and entertainment has shifted from the movie theater to the streaming screen. Platforms like Netflix, Disney+, and Amazon Prime have revitalized the genre by turning romantic stories into multi-episode series rather than two-hour films. This shift allows for deeper character development, slower burns, and more complex world-building.
Human beings are wired for connection. Since the dawn of storytelling, narratives centered on love, passion, conflict, and heartbreak have dominated global culture. In modern media, the fusion of "romantic drama and entertainment" represents one of the most lucrative and enduring sectors of the film, television, and literary industries. From the tragic poetry of Shakespeare’s Romeo and Juliet to the binge-worthy tension of modern streaming hits like Bridgerton , romantic drama continues to captivate audiences worldwide. Korean dramas (K-dramas) have mastered the art of the romantic drama. Shows like Crash Landing on You , Goblin , and Queen of Tears command billions of views globally. Their success lies in immaculate pacing, high-stakes plots (often involving class divides or supernatural elements), and an emphasis on emotional intimacy over explicit content, making them accessible to a broad global audience. From an industry perspective, romantic drama is a remarkably resilient business model. Unlike action blockbusters that require hundreds of millions of dollars in visual effects, romantic dramas rely heavily on scriptwriting, chemistry, and performance. Romantic drama remains an essential cornerstone of global entertainment because it validates the human experience. It reassures us that our struggles with intimacy, loneliness, rejection, and passion are universally shared. No matter how much technology changes how we consume media, we will always pull up a chair, dim the lights, and tune in to watch two people fall in love against all odds.

Because streaming platforms prioritize viewer retention (hours watched) over ticket sales, they have realized that nothing retains a viewer like a slow-burn love story. A thriller might keep you on the edge of your seat for two hours, but a series will keep you binge-watching for six.
